Another GDPR related question.
We have been getting revised contract terms to incorporate GDPR related issues. One of the points we have come across is requests to increase insurance liability to cover Cybermedia data breaches. In one instance the requested increase is 20 times our current liability level. The data we hold and process for the controller is basic contact details (e.g. name, email, telephone and in some instances signatures).
The question is what criteria should we think about when we consider if we need to increase our insurance liability? We have done some thinking about this but we want to be as confident as possible in our assessment before making any changes.
